Transaction 61afc73824034016fbb2591370047cfb8bc3b0fc046e95ff07ba2fb6f20ed9d8
1 Input
1 Output
-
61afc73824034016fbb2591370047cfb8bc3b0fc046e95ff07ba2fb6f20ed9d8:0
- value
- 786406
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d247d583632022d98407eaf95dec5bbc5b27cd3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KhhEfoU3582KvPyq6mfjZYLAmMoeHXocW